第3章 指令系统资料.ppt

4、位条件转移类指令(5条) (1) 判布尔累加器C转移指令(2条) (2)判位变量转移指令(2条) 汇编指令 机器码 操 作 JC rel 0100 0000 rel 先(PC)+2→PC 若(C)=1,则(PC)+rel→PC; 否则(C)=0,程序顺序执行。 JNC rel 0101 0000 rel 先(PC)+2→PC 若(C) =0,则(PC)+rel→PC; 否则(C)= 1,程序顺序执行。 汇编指令 机器码 操 作 JB bit,rel 0010 0000 bit rel 先(PC)+3→PC 若(bit)=1,则(PC)+rel→PC; 否则(bit)=0,程序顺序执行。 JNB bit,rel 0011 0000 bit rel 先(PC)+3→PC 若(bit) =0,则(PC)+rel→PC; 否则(bit)= 1,程序顺序执行。 (3)判位变量并清0转移指令(1条) 汇编指令 机器码 操 作 JBC bit,rel 0001 0000 bit rel 先 (PC)+3→PC 若 (bit)=1,则(PC)+rel→PC,0→bit; 否则 (bit)=0,程序顺序执行。 例如:编程设计,若片内RAM 30H单元内容大于0,40H单元置00;30H单元内容小于 0,40H单元置FFH; 30H单元内容等于0,40H单元置1; 例如

文档评论(0)

1亿VIP精品文档

相关文档